for Question 1: round the answer to the nearest cent.

On Janusry 1, 2019, Loud Company enters into a 2 year contract with a customer for an unlimited tak and 5 GB data wireless plan for 566 per month. The contract includes a smartphone for which the customer pays \$299. Loud also sells the smartphone and monthly service plan separately, charging \$649 for the smarlphone and \$65 for the monthly service for the unlimited talk and 5GB data wireless plan. On July 1,2019, the customer realizes that she needs less data in her wireless plan and downgrades to the unilmited tak and 2 GB data plan for the remaining term of the contract (18 months). The unlimited talk and 2GB data plan is priced at $55 por month. The $55 per month is Loud's curtent stand-alone price tor this plan that is available to all customers. Aequired: 1. How should Loud account for this contract modilication? 2. Provide Loud's new monthly revenue recognition joumal entry. 1. How should Loud account for this contract modification? Acditionai instrielian The contract modification add goods or services to the arrangelnent, therefore, this modification be treated as a separate contract. However, to determine the appropriate accounting for the moditication, the entily has to assess whether the remaining goods and services (18 months of service) are goods and services already provided to the customer (handset and 6 manths of services). On July 1, the contract receivable has a remaining balance of As a result, the entity has to allocate to the remaining 18 months of service, or per month. 2.
